Ahmed Calls for Council of Ulamas to Moderate Islamic Preaching

Date: 2013-05-06

The Kwara State Governor, Dr Abdulfatah Ahmed has advocated the institutionalization of a council of Ulamas for the moderation of preaching by Islamic clerics in order to ensure that such sermons are in accordance with Islamic tenets.

Governor Ahmed made the call at the weekend during the public presentation of a book, Language Skills for Arabic Students, adding that the council should be composed of reputable and knowledgeable Islamic Scholar.

“Such a move will also provide an opportunity to instill in our youths, the values of peaceful co-existence, love, integrity and equity which, Insha Allah, will insulate them from fundamentalist preaching through the internet and other sources”, he said.

The Governor who stressed that Muslims must not allow the action of a few to define Muslims and shape perception of Islam, averred that leaders in all spheres of life should always preach eternal values of peaceful coexistence as enshrined in the Holy Quran in order to counter the stigmatization of Islam.

Governor Ahmed, through copious references to various chapters of the Holy Quran stressed that muslims must shun acts of violence by safeguarding the lives of the innocent at all times.

On the book, the governor expressed the hope that it will deepen the teaching and understanding of Arabic, a language which he said had made valuable contributions to the development of human kind.
